The following is a mystery that I have inherited from the previous tech.
writer. He posted this on the Quadralay sight. One response was that this
problem is cured with WW 7.0. I am throwing this out to all of you to see if
anyone can think of any other options. I am using FrameMaker 6.0 and
WebWorks Publisher 6.0. Please note that the output is Java Help.
We have a multivolume WebWorksHelp system based on 6 different Frame
books/WW projects.
Everything works fine with the combined system, EXCEPT that the Index is
deeply flawed.
On the left-frame Index tab, there is a long list of index entries; however,
the entries for two of the six projects are ABSENT.
When you click on an entry in the left frame, the right frame shows
something like the following:
<name of an index entry> (unlinked text)
...followed by a list of topic names that are hyperlinks to the
corresponding topics.
HOWEVER, <name of index entry> is NOT the same index entry that was clicked
on the left side. In a further twist, <index entry> is always one of the
ABSENT index entries mentioned in the 3rd paragraph above.
